Cooking Steps

1
1

• Preheat oven to 180°C/160°C fan-forced. • In a small saucepan, melt the butter over medium-high heat, until beginning to brown, 2-3 minutes. Set aside until cooled slightly, 5 minutes. • While the butter is cooling, line a 20cm square baking tin with baking paper.

2
2

• In a medium bowl, combine blondie mix, the eggs and browned butter.

3
3

•Pour blondie mixture into the prepared baking tin and spread evenly using a spatula. • Bake blondie until just firm to the touch, 25-28 minutes. • Leave to cool in the tin for 15 minutes. TIP: To check if the blondie is baked, stick a toothpick or skewer in the centre. It should come out clean.

4
4

• Slice blondie into 8 squares. • Serve blondies warm on a serving plate. Enjoy!
